Internet Addiction has emerged as a new clinical disorder - often requiring treatment. In some global regions, internet addiction is reaching epidemic proportions and has become a serious public health concern.In this timely book, Author Stevie White gives a first-hand account of the ever-evolving 'Internet Phenomenon' and how millions of people are falling into the over-usage or addiction category. The first part of the book explores the research and prevalence of Internet Addiction (IAD) before explaining the underlying signs & symptoms and the various types of online addiction. Finally, the implications of over-usage are discussed in terms of personal health risks.The second part of the book provides a framework for recovery and examines the self-help strategies and therapy programs that can help a person with problematic internet over-usage to gain back some control. Concluding chapters explore the need for self-analysis and counseling, to following ergonomic principles for safer technology usage and the benefits of pursuing meditation for calming the mind. The book includes various recreation and exercise suggestions and time management strategies that can assist an individual break away from online activities. The final chapter discusses spirituality as a mechanism for those who are in a state of despair or helplessness.
